Understanding the Principles of Holistic Skincare

The foundation of holistic skincare lies in its integrative approach. It acknowledges that the skin is not merely a surface to be treated but a reflection of overall health. Factors such as diet, stress levels, sleep quality, and even emotional well-being are seen as interconnected with skin health. This perspective shifts the focus from symptom management to addressing underlying imbalances.

In holistic skincare, the body is viewed as a network of systems that work together to maintain balance. For example, digestive health directly affects skin clarity, while chronic stress can lead to inflammatory skin conditions. By adopting practices that support all aspects of health, holistic skincare routines aim to create harmony both inside and out. This integrative perspective not only improves the appearance of the skin but also enhances overall wellness.

Key Components of a Holistic Skincare Routine

Creating an effective holistic skincare routine involves more than applying topical treatments. It requires a commitment to nourishing the body from within and supporting it through mindful lifestyle choices. The key components of a holistic skincare regimen include:

  1. Nutrient-Rich Diet – What you consume plays a vital role in skin health. Diets rich in ant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als support skin repair and combat oxidative stress.
  2. Mindful Hydration – Hydration is essential for maintaining skin elasticity and flushing out toxins. Drinking plenty of water and consuming hydrating foods like cucumbers and watermelon support cellular function.
  3. Stress Management – Chronic stress triggers hormonal imbalances that can result in breakouts and dull skin. Practices such as meditation, yoga, and deep breathing can significantly improve skin health.
  4. Physical Activity – Regular exercise boosts circulation, delivering oxygen and nutrients to skin cells while aiding in detoxification.
  5. Natural Skincare Products – Using products free from harmful chemicals and rich in botanical extracts aligns with holistic principles and supports the skin’s natural barrier.

Embracing Nature’s Wisdom: Ingredients for Holistic Skincare

One of the cornerstones of holistic skincare is the use of natural, plant-based ingredients that work in harmony with the skin’s natural processes. Ingredients such as aloe vera, chamomile, and calendula are celebrated for their soothing properties, while green tea and vitamin E provide antioxidant protection against environmental stressors.

Holistic skincare also encourages the use of adaptogens—botanical extracts that help the body adapt to stress and restore balance. Herbs like ashwagandha and ginseng are known to promote skin resilience, combat signs of aging, and enhance overall vitality. These natural elements serve not only to treat the skin but to nourish it deeply, supporting long-term health and radiance.

Adapting Holistic Skincare to Your Environment

Holistic skincare is not a one-size-fits-all approach; it evolves with the seasons and adapts to different environmental conditions. In colder months, the skin tends to be drier and more susceptible to irritation. This is the ideal time to incorporate richer, more hydrating oils such as argan and avocado oil, which penetrate deeply and shield the skin against harsh elements.

Conversely, in warmer climates, lighter moisturizers with ingredients like aloe vera and cucumber extract help keep the skin hydrated without clogging pores. By adjusting your routine to the environment, holistic skincare promotes balance and protects the skin from environmental stressors that accelerate aging and dryness.

Furthermore, holistic skincare emphasizes protection from pollutants and environmental toxins. Using products that contain antioxidants like vitamin C and green tea can neutralize free radicals, preventing oxidative damage. This proactive approach not only maintains the skin’s health but also preserves its youthful appearance over time.

Can Holistic Skincare Address Chronic Skin Conditions?

Yes, holistic skincare can be highly effective in managing chronic skin conditions such as eczema, psoriasis, and rosacea. Unlike conventional treatments that may focus on symptom suppression, holistic skin care treatments emphasize restoring balance within the body. This may include dietary adjustments, stress management, and the application of botanical extracts known for their anti-inflammatory properties. For example, calendula and chamomile are often used to soothe irritated skin, while omega-rich oils can help rebuild the skin barrier. By addressing root causes, holistic skincare aims to reduce flare-ups and improve overall skin health over time.

What Should I Avoid When Practicing Holistic Skincare?

When practicing holistic skincare, it’s important to avoid products that contain harsh chemicals like sulfates, parabens, and artificial fragrances. These ingredients can disrupt the skin’s natural balance and may lead to long-term damage. Instead, opt for natural, organic formulations that are gentle and supportive of the skin’s natural healing processes. Additionally, avoid over-exfoliating or using overly aggressive treatments, as holistic skin care emphasizes gentle nurturing rather than forceful intervention. Focusing on balance and sustainability ensures that your holistic skincare journey is both safe and effective.
